  • Roland Unveils Digital Handheld Recorder At Music Messe 2008

    Edirol by Roland announces the newest addition to its award-winning line of portable digital recorders, the R-09HR. Featuring an updated design with an upgraded pro-quality stereo microphone and an onboard preview speaker for instant audio playback, the R-09HR takes pristine portable recording to a new level.

    The R-09HR features ultra high-quality condenser microphone elements and new low-noise preamp circuitry for professional quality recordings on the go. Users can record in .WAV or MP3 formats with resolution up to 24bit/96kHz, and can easily navigate recordings with its larger, wider high-contrast LED screen.

    The R-09HR also comes with a wireless remote controller for convenient operation from a distance. It offers advanced features like speed control, variable low-cut filter, limiter, A-B repeat, record pause, time and date stamping, power save and more. The R-09HR records to SD/SDHC media cards up to 32GB, and includes Cakewalk's Pyro Audio Creator LE software for simple audio editing functions.

    Slightly taller than its predecessor and featuring a new rubberized-grip body, the battery-powered R-09HR allows over 6 hours of recording with Alkaline batteries, and over 8 hours of recording with NiMH rechargeable batteries.
